The changes of social culture is a unavoidable tendency. With the rapid development of tourism and tourist industry, ethnic tourism plays a more and more important role in the process of the cultural changes of ethnic areas and becomes a most vital factor in promoting the social and cultural changes of ethnic groups. Tourism development has both positive and negative effect on the growing of ethnic areas. It not only pushes forward the village economy of ethnic areas, but also greatly influences the traditional cultures of ethnic villages in direct or indirect way. It has been a topic of general interest in related fields to study the compact of ethnic tourism on social culture and to explore how to realize virtuous changes of ethnic cultures in a modern and open social pattern.In this article, as a case in point, the Qiang Village in Taoping is a typical one in the villages of the Qiang nationality. Since the 1990s, ethnic tourism has been in a special position in the social and cultural changes of Taoping village and has become the most important factor which is affecting its cultural and social changes . After 10 years of tourism development, there have been great changes in the social culture of Taoping village. This article presents and analyses the changes of the social culture of Taoping village in terms of material, systematic and spiritual culture. On the basis of the analysis of this typical case, this article explores the topic on protecting tradition ethnic cultures in the process of developing tourism and realizing continuous development of the ethnic villages.
